High-performance sensor based on surface plasmon resonance with chalcogenide prism and aluminum for detection in infrared
A high-accuracy aluminum-based surface plasmon resonance (SPR) chalcogenide sensor is proposed for IR. The structure is based on widely used 2S2G chalcogenide glass with aluminum as the SPR active metal.
